Wishing Well, Artifact, designed by Steven Belledin first released in Jul, 2024 in the set Bloomburrow and was printed exactly in 4 different ways.
A control or tempo deck that focuses on casting instants and sorceries would benefit from using Wishing Well in Magic: the Gathering. While Wishing Well offers a unique ability to cast spells from the graveyard for free, it may be overshadowed by more efficient cards like Snapcaster Mage or Torrential Gearhulk, which provide similar effects with added value. Wishing Well could see play in casual or budget decks, but in competitive environments, other options may be more effective.
